gateway: converge, don't start/stop/reload
The gateway is a deployment (castle-gateway) — its lifecycle is the same convergence as everything else, so the bespoke start/stop/reload verbs (which still routed through the retired enable/disable path) are gone. - CLI: `castle gateway` is now inspection only — bare or `status` shows the route table. Start/stop/reload it via `castle apply` (render routes + reload) or `castle restart castle-gateway`. Deletes the last users of `_service_enable`/`_service_disable`, so those are removed too. - API: retire `POST /gateway/reload` (making routes live is `POST /apply`); `PUT /gateway/config` message + docstring now say apply, not deploy. - UI: GatewayPanel's "Reload" button → "Apply" (useApply); drop the useGatewayReload hook; GatewaySettings points at `castle apply`. - docs: `castle gateway reload|status` → `castle gateway` (status lens). core 129 / cli 31 / api 59 pass; dashboard builds clean; live `castle gateway` shows routes with no start/stop/reload; /gateway/reload removed from the API.
